Only downside I’ve seen is that I had so much fun with it my low fuel light came on at 250 miles.

Once I settled down, though, my mileage has improved by 1-2 MPG.

Underdriving hasn’t hurt any of my electronics except power steering: when the car is cold and barely moving, it’s a little tougher to turn. Nothing big.

I do have to say, now that it’s been a couple of weeks, the fun has worn off quite a bit. I still know the power is there, but it’s easy to forget. All-in-all, very much worth the money though.
